Difference Between Automated and Manual Pallet Wrapping Methods
When it comes to wrapping pallets, you have two primary methods to choose from: automated and manual. Understanding the differences between these methods will help you select the best option for your needs.
Automated Pallet Wrapping
Automated pallet wrapping utilizes machines to wrap pallets quickly and consistently. These machines come in various forms, such as automated palletizers and automatic wrapping machines.
Benefits of Automated Wrapping:
- Consistent Wrap Quality: Machines provide uniform wrapping for each pallet, ensuring the same level of protection and stability.
- Speed and Efficiency: Automated systems can wrap pallets much faster than manual methods, increasing operational efficiency.
- Labor Savings: Reduces the need for manual labor, allowing workers to focus on other tasks.
Drawbacks of Automated Wrapping:
- Initial Investment: The upfront cost of purchasing and installing wrapping machines can be high.
- Maintenance: Machines require regular maintenance and repairs, which can add to operational costs.
Aspect | Automated Wrapping | Manual Wrapping |
---|---|---|
Speed | Fast | Slow |
Consistency | High | Varies |
Labor Requirement | Low | High |
Initial Cost | High | Low |
Manual Pallet Wrapping
Manual wrapping involves workers using stretch film or other wrapping materials to secure pallets by hand. This method is usually employed in smaller operations or where automation isn’t feasible.
Benefits of Manual Wrapping:
- Flexibility: Ideal for smaller or irregularly shaped loads that may not be suitable for automated machines.
- Lower Initial Cost: Requires no significant capital investment apart from the cost of wrapping materials.
- Simple to Implement: Easier to set up and use without the need for special training.
Drawbacks of Manual Wrapping:
- Inconsistency: The quality of wrapping can vary depending on the skill and technique of the worker.
- Time-Consuming: Slower compared to automated methods, potentially impacting overall productivity.
- Physical Strain: Manual wrapping can be physically demanding, increasing the risk of worker injury.

Process of Manual Pallet Wrapping
Manual pallet wrapping involves wrapping pallets by hand using stretch film. This method is simple and cost-effective, especially for small-scale operations. Here’s a step-by-step guide to manual pallet wrapping:
- Position the Pallet: Place your pallet on a flat, stable surface. Ensure that the load is stacked evenly.
- Anchor the Film: Attach the end of the stretch film to the bottom corner of the pallet.
- Wrap the Base: Walk around the pallet, pulling the film tight to secure the base. Wrap at least twice around the base.
- Ascend the Pallet: Gradually move upward, overlapping each layer of film. Ensure that the film is kept taut to provide maximum stability.
- Secure the Top: Once you reach the top, wrap at least twice to secure the load.
- Tidy the End: Cut the film and press it against the previous layer to ensure it stays in place.

Process of Automated Pallet Wrapping
The automated pallet wrapping process involves the use of machines to stretch wrap the pallets. Here’s a step-by-step guide:
- Loading the Pallet: The pallet is placed on a turntable or conveyor system that’s part of the wrapping machine.
- Securing the Film: The machine secures the stretch film to the pallet or the load.
- Wrapping: The machine rotates the pallet while dispensing the film in a controlled manner. The film is stretched and wrapped tightly around the pallet.
- Cutting the Film: Once the wrapping is complete, the machine cuts the film and secures the end to the pallet.
- Unloading: The wrapped pallet is removed from the machine, ready for transport or storage.
Pros and Cons of Automated Pallet Wrapping
Automated pallet wrapping offers several advantages and a few drawbacks. Here’s a detailed look at the pros and cons:
Pros | Cons |
---|---|
Efficiency: Automated machines can wrap pallets quickly, significantly reducing labor time. | Initial Cost: Purchasing and installing an automated wrapping machine involves a significant upfront investment. |
Consistency: The wrapping quality is uniform and consistent, ensuring every pallet is wrapped effectively. | Maintenance: Machines require regular maintenance and occasional repairs to function optimally. |
Safety: Automating the wrapping process minimizes manual handling, reducing the risk of workplace injuries. | Complexity: Operating and maintaining automated machines requires specialized training. |
Material Savings: Automated machines can precisely control film tension, reducing film waste. | Space Requirements: Automated systems take up more space compared to manual methods. |

Choosing the Right Method for Your Needs
Factors to Consider When Selecting Wrapping Method
When choosing the best method for wrapping pallets, several factors should guide your decision. Understanding these aspects will help ensure that your goods are securely wrapped and can withstand the rigors of transportation and storage.
Volume of Shipments:
If you handle high-volume shipments, automated wrapping might be more efficient. For smaller volumes, manual wrapping could suffice.
Shipment Volume Recommended Wrapping Method Low (1-20 pallets/day) Manual Medium (21-50 pallets/day) Either High (51+ pallets/day) Automated Type of Goods:
Fragile items may benefit from the consistent tension that automated wrapping provides. For irregularly shaped goods, manual wrapping allows for more control.
Budget:
Initial costs and sustainability should be considered. Automated wrapping systems often have a higher upfront cost but can save money over time by reducing labor costs.
Space Availability:
Evaluate the space in your facility. Automated wrapping machines take up more room compared to the space required for manual wrapping.
Labor:
Consider the availability and cost of labor. Automated systems can reduce the need for manual labor, which might be beneficial in labor-scarce conditions.
